The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in South London with a requirement for Kafka sk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Kafka over the 6 months to 6 May 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
6 May 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 89 83 125
Rank change year-on-year -6 +42 -52
Permanent jobs citing Kafka 5 9 19
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in South London 0.56% 1.17% 1.57%
As % of the Libraries, Frameworks & Software Standards category 4.07% 2.71% 3.30%
Number of salaries quoted 3 5 13
10th Percentile £80,500 - -
25th Percentile £88,750 - £47,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£105,000 £75,000 £85,000
Median % change year-on-year +40.00% -11.76% +13.33%
75th Percentile £111,875 - £87,500
90th Percentile £114,500 £82,500 £100,000
London median annual salary £92,500 £100,000 £87,500
% change year-on-year -7.50% +14.29% +9.38%
